Footprints

We all leave footprints
where ever we go
some are easily seen
some barely show
With the passage of time
some will fade away
while others will last
until your dying day
They show the wear on your shoes
and how heavy your load
where you've come from
and the direction you go
You cannot choose
where your path begins
and have little control
over how it will end
What matters most
is the choices you make
how far you travel
and the road you take
Whether they last forever
or quickly fade
that others are better
for the footprints you made

Like a Child

Live life like a child
take joy in each new day
be happy with the little things
don't worry what others say

Don't take joy from a child
don't take their dreams away
when their imagination takes flight
listen to what they say

When a child cries or shouts
it's not always right or wrong
not stubborn but maybe broken
because they're not that strong

Think about what they've been through
consider where they are
cold rules and expectations
can only go so far

Open your mind and listen
then answer from your heart
so lessons learned will resonate
even when you're far apart

Don't be so hard, don't be so tough
let the love inside you show
your kindness just might touch someone
that you don't even know

Angry words they hurt so much
and can never be unsaid
in the silence they can haunt you
and stay inside your head

So be careful what you say
and let your anger go
it's not so complicated
not much you need to know

Give a little of yourself
ease another's load
love one another
is all you need to know

Always

From the day that he was born
He meant the world to me
I said I'd always be there
That i would never leave

Someone to hold his hand
Someone to lead the way
To tuck him in each night
And be there every day

He said it's just the two of us
It's always you and me
Thats the way it always was
How it's supposed to be

But changes come and go
It's just a part of life
Too young to understand
He just knows that it's not right

How do i make him understand
How can i make him see
The way it always was
Can now no longer be

You say it's for the best
But is that really true
Every minute that you're gone
Is a minute that you lose

Is it really worth it
Is it what you need to do
If he gains the world
But loses part of you

Choices hard and full of pain
So think before you act
Because precious moments lost
Are never coming back

Chains

Why did i give my heart away
when i was so young
why didn't i know better
my life had just begun
But something so easily given
is not so easy to return
a fact that life has taught me
a lesson i have learned
Now shackled in these chains
i've put upon myself
down this path i've chosen
to follow someone else
I hear freedom calling
how i love the sound
from the darkness that surrounds me
down this road i'm bound
Now my sight is turned inside myself
to see who i've become
innocence lost forever
for someone still so young

I didn't want to do it
but did i really have a choice?
that gaining freedom for myself
meant hurting someone else
Time heals wounds
at least that's what they say
but it doesn't really matter
i could see no other way
Now my life is so much better
free from all those chains
to go anywhere i choose
my heart is mine again
